[post_page_title]What lies beneath[/post_page_title]
Some dog breeds need a lot of grooming to keep their fur in check. Without it, they could end up with a matted coat, mange, or even contract fleas and ticks. All of these are a recipe for various health issues. So when this little one arrived at the shelter, the staff knew they had to take their fur off to find out what lay beneath. Amazingly, there was a completely different pooch hiding underneath the layers of fluff that had overgrown over the years. Now they can start enjoying life and their new haircut.
